Jan 8, 2024 · What to Know. Reset the launcher: Settings > Apps > Default apps > Home app > pick the original launcher. Hide or delete apps: Tap-and-hold one, choose Remove to hide, Uninstall to delete. Widgets are similar. Reset the wallpaper: Tap-and-hold the home screen, choose Wallpaper & style or Wallpaper. Pick a new one.

Sep 21, 2023 · If your Android phone won't boot or you're locked out and forgot your password, you can still perform a factory reset using Recovery Mode, but you'll need to sign in with the same Google account afterwards.
Perform a factory reset to resolve intermittent errors or before gifting to a friend. A factory reset of your device removes all downloaded content, including in-app purchases and returns the device to its original factory settings. If needed, safely eject expandable storage.
